Output c6b20b7b95d9b1f8a0ddfc83121a2617d3f1b15ba1262ec2ed7ec11230057d6e:0

value
638000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 693263bd5cb1315371b57da3e744eee8b77aee66 OP_EQUAL
address
3BHFEpMfPv2rtST2zwuzDvsFPZrarPSKHv
transaction
c6b20b7b95d9b1f8a0ddfc83121a2617d3f1b15ba1262ec2ed7ec11230057d6e
spent
true